    [SIZE=3]Day 11. LEAGUE (Round 9).

    FC BLUE KINGS (81.1) 1-5 (97.7) LONDON CITY

    For seventy minutes of this match, it looked as if we were going to be frustrated with a third successive draw, but a double substitution changed the game into our favour. It started well, when Wayne Dixon dribbled his way through and fired us ahead. It remained at 1-0 until halftime. Right at the start of the second period, Essemlali grabbed an equaliser. The game turned when Sani Negedu was injured by a poor tackle after 55 minutes. Vener Chekmarev replaced Negedu, and shortly after, we sent on Calvin Charlton for Chris Pigott. Suddenly we took complete control and three goals in less than three minutes, made it far more comfortable for us. Charlton got the first, taking a pass from Dixon to put us back in front. Less than a minute later, Shinji Noda blasted another, and straight from the restart we won possession and Declan Jones set up his fellow defender, Marcos Lepe to get our fourth. With time running out, Chekmarev scored from a free kick to complete the rout. Declan Jones claimed man of the match.

    Day 16. LEAGUE (Round 14).

    LONDON CITY (98.0) 2-1 (90.7) AC GREENFIRE

    We came away with a valuable win in this ill tempered match which saw our manager, Billy Wheeler sent to the stand, and injuries to two of our players, including the league's leading scorer, Wayne Dixon. Dixon opened the scoring with a solo effort on 23 minutes, and we led 1-0 at the interval. After the break, things really turned nasty, and winger Sergio Bilbao was injured after a crude tackle by Sunden. Just over ten minutes later, Dixon was also injured after another hard tackle, this time by Pavez. Almost immediately, Lanaras forced an equaliser. The tackles were still flying in, and Martin received his second yellow of the match, to leave Greenfire to play the last six minutes with ten men, during which time, Aiden James produced some magic and blasted our winning goal. Despite missing the final half hour, Dixon still won the man of the match award.
